Butterfly bush p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ping butterfly bushes to promote healthy growth and vibrant blooms. This process typically includes removing dead or damaged branches, thinning out overgrown stems, and shaping the shrub to maintain its desired size and form. Proper pruning encourages better airflow within the plant, which can reduce the risk of disease and pest issues. Experienced service providers understand the best techniques to ensure the butterfly bush remains vigorous and attractive throughout the growing season.
Pruning is especially helpful for solving common problems such as leggy growth, overcrowding, and the presence of dead or diseased branches. Without regular trimming, butterfly bushes can become unruly, making them difficult to manage and potentially diminishing their flowering potential. Overgrown plants may also block sunlight from reaching lower branches, leading to weak growth or dieback. Professional pruning helps to keep the shrub healthy, well-shaped, and more likely to produce abundant blooms year after year.

The overview below groups typical Butterfly Bush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Jacksonville,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Pruning - Most routine Butterfly Bush pruning projects in Jacksonville, NC typically cost between $250 and $600. These jobs usually involve trimming overgrown branches to maintain shape and health. Fewer projects fall into the higher end of this range unless additional services are requested.
Moderate Shaping - Mid-sized pruning services, including selective branch removal and shaping, generally range from $600 to $1,200.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ly, with costs increasing for larger or more complex bushes.
Heavy Renovation - Extensive pruning or rejuvenation work can range from $1,200 to $2,500, especially for older or heavily overgrown bushes. Such projects are less common but may be necessary for significant overgrowth or disease control.
Full Replacement or Major Landscaping - Complete removal and replacement of Butterfly Bushes or large-scale landscape redesigns can exceed $3,000, with larger, more intricate projects reaching $5,000 or more. These are typically less frequent and involve comprehensive planning and labor.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why is Butterfly Bush pruning important? Proper pruning helps maintain the plant's shape, encourages healthy growth, and promotes abundant flowering throughout the season.
When is the best time to prune Butterfly Bushes? The ideal time for pruning is typically in early spring before new growth begins, but local contractors can advise based on the specific climate in Jacksonville, NC.
What tools are needed for Butterfly Bush pruning? Common tools include pruning shears for small branches and loppers for thicker stems, which local service providers can recommend based on the size of the shrub.
Can Butterfly Bushes be pruned to control size? Yes, pruning can be used to manage the size and shape of Butterfly Bushes, with professional contractors able to perform precise cuts for desired results.
Are there any specific pruning techniques for Butterfly Bushes? Techniques include cutting back old wood to encourage new growth and removing dead or damaged branches, which local specialists are experienced in executing effectively.
